Book balcony cabins on starboard for morning light in eastward routes. Monitor swell forecasts via apps like Windy for stable shooting windows. Align trips with solstice for extended twilights over oceans.
Stabilize gear against pitch with deck mounts during dawn patrols. Scout rail angles pre-sail for recurring compositions like wake trails. Log metadata for post-edits compensating ship motion.
Practice panning seabirds mid-voyage to hone skills. Pack ND filters for harsh equatorial glare. Venture solo to foredecks at night for bioluminescent wakes.
